Essential fatty acid deficiency can lead to dry, flaky skin, inflammation, and a weakened skin barrier. This can result in skin conditions such as eczema, acne, and premature aging, affecting the skin's overall health and appearance.

How can mineral deficiency impact the health and appearance of nails?

Mineral deficiency can weaken nails, making them brittle and prone to breaking. This can lead to ridges, discoloration, and slow growth. Iron deficiency, for example, can cause nails to become concave or spoon-shaped. Overall, a lack of essential minerals can negatively affect the health and appearance of nails.


How does photoaging of the skin impact the overall health and appearance of an individual's complexion?

Photoaging of the skin, caused by prolonged sun exposure, can lead to wrinkles, age spots, and uneven skin tone. This can impact the overall health and appearance of an individual's complexion by making the skin look older, dull, and less vibrant. It can also increase the risk of skin cancer and other skin-related issues.

What happens if i don't get enough cobalt in your body?

Cobalt is essential for the production of vitamin B12, which is crucial for red blood cell formation and nervous system health. A deficiency in cobalt can lead to anemia, fatigue, neurological issues, and problems with DNA synthesis. While cobalt deficiency is rare due to its presence in various foods, inadequate levels can impact overall health and metabolic functions.


What is effect of salt deficiency?

Salt deficiency, or hyponatremia, can lead to a range of health issues, including muscle cramps, weakness, and fatigue. Severe cases may result in confusion, seizures, and even coma due to the disruption of electrolyte balance, which is essential for proper nerve and muscle function. Additionally, prolonged salt deficiency can impact overall fluid balance in the body, leading to dehydration and related complications. It's crucial to maintain adequate sodium levels for optimal health.

Does iron deficiency cause goiter?

Iron deficiency does not directly cause goiter, which is primarily associated with iodine deficiency. Goiter refers to the enlargement of the thyroid gland, often resulting from insufficient iodine needed for thyroid hormone production. However, iron deficiency can impact overall thyroid function and metabolism, potentially exacerbating conditions related to thyroid health, but it is not a direct cause of goiter.

What illness can you get if you don't have the right amount of minerlas?

A deficiency in essential minerals can lead to various illnesses, depending on which minerals are lacking. For example, inadequate calcium intake can result in osteoporosis, while insufficient iron can cause anemia. Magnesium deficiency may lead to muscle cramps and heart issues, and a lack of potassium can affect heart and muscle function. Overall, mineral deficiencies can significantly impact overall health and well-being.
